With the Boston Whaler 285 Conquest, anything is possible, thanks to comfort-minded features and amenities geared for active day cruises, serious fishing runs and impromptu overnighting. Offshore trips are a pleasure thanks to design details that maximize helm visibility, seating comfort, storage space and more. The boat's welcoming cabin sleeps four with a plush forward V-berth/dinette and a mid-cabin double berth, as well as optional HDTV, a deluxe galley and a private head. When you're not entertaining a crowd in the generous cockpit, go out and find the big fish: the 285 Conquest is fully equipped for offshore runs. Choose from three hard-top options to suit your own horizons; any which way, the Conquest is the perfect new fishing boat to conquer the day.

Boston Whaler 285 Conquest: BoatTEST Review

Reviewed by Jeff Hammond

Overview

The Boston Whaler 285 Conquest is a versatile crossover model that effectively bridges the gap between a capable fishing vessel and a comfortable cruising platform suitable for offshore conditions. This model incorporates thoughtful design updates and features that enhance both functionality and comfort, making it well-suited for a variety of boating activities ranging from fishing excursions to family overnight trips.

Exterior Design and Deck Features

The 285 Conquest features a foredeck fully covered in non-skid material, with an optional cushion pad that transforms the area into a sun lounge. The windshield extends seamlessly to integrate with the hardtop, eliminating the need for Isinglass panels and providing a clean, aerodynamic profile. An electrically actuated vent atop the windshield efficiently channels fresh air into the helm deck. At the aft edge of the hardtop, LED spreader lights are installed alongside rocket launcher rod holders. Safety and accessibility are emphasized with a 15.5-inch wide passage between rails and cabin sides, grab handles along the hardtop, sturdy aft ladder supports, and a step leading into the cockpit. The side decks are molded to channel water away from the cockpit, enhancing dryness and safety. The starboard transom door, positioned nine inches above the main deck, leads to a modest swim platform equipped with a recessed three-step reboarding ladder and stainless steel grab handle. A standard transom shower is connected to a 30-gallon freshwater tank.

Cockpit and Fishing Amenities

The cockpit spans 54 square feet and is designed for both fishing and cruising configurations. Fishing features include a transom-mounted livewell with a gasketed acrylic lid, electrical connections under the gunwales for downriggers, and rod storage racks with tow rails for added security during angling. Two sizable fish boxes flank the cockpit, each with lightweight Divinacell cord hatches supported by gas-assist struts. For cruising comfort, the cockpit is surrounded by bolsters ranging from 21.5 to 28 inches in height, providing safety and comfort. A standard flip-out bench seat at the stern is easy to deploy, with an optional second flip-out bench under the port bulwarks to create a spacious gathering area. Additional options include a cockpit table with a flexi-teak top for dining and a forward sink with a pull-out sprayer. Storage beneath the sink can be customized to include a cockpit refrigerator.

Helm Deck and Seating

The helm deck features an improved seating arrangement with opposing seats to port, which can be converted into a lounge area using a filler cushion. The aft seat includes a sliding seat-back that converts it into an aft-facing seat, complemented by a pull-out step below. This versatile seating configuration enhances social interaction and provides an excellent vantage point for line watching during fishing activities.

Interior Living Spaces

Below deck, the 285 Conquest offers a modest galley to port equipped with a microwave, single-burner stove, sink, and refrigerator. Natural light is provided by hull-side portlights and an overhead skylight. The ship's electrical panel is conveniently located adjacent to the microwave. Just aft of the galley is a mid-berth measuring four by six feet, featuring a variable geometry overhead that ranges from 1 foot 9 inches to 2 feet 5 inches, peaking at 4 feet at the entry. A leather headboard with storage is positioned behind the berth. The test boat includes an optional cabin comfort package with bedding and a privacy curtain. Forward is a U-shaped settee with overhead rod storage; the rod holders flip away when not in use. A dinette table with an extendable leaf occupies the center of the settee, and the entire area converts into a berth by lowering the table and repositioning the cushions. Flip-down garment hooks are mounted on the aft bulkhead.

Private Accommodations and Head

The starboard side houses a wet head that, while modest in size, is fully fiberglass-lined and offers ample storage. Boston Whaler has equipped the head with a standard vacu-flush toilet, providing convenience and comfort for overnight stays or extended cruising.

Conclusion

The Boston Whaler 285 Conquest is a thoughtfully designed vessel that balances fishing capabilities with cruising comfort. Its versatile layout, safety features, and well-appointed interior make it suitable for a wide range of boating activities, whether heading offshore with a group of anglers, enjoying an overnight family trip, or entertaining friends on a day cruise.

The Biggest Pros and Cons

The 2016 Boston Whaler 285 Conquest is a versatile center console boat known for its blend of fishing capability and family-friendly features. Here are some pros and cons to consider:

Pros

Unmatched Stability and Safety: Built with Boston Whaler’s signature unsinkable hull, offering peace of mind on the water.

Spacious and Functional Layout: Features a well-designed cockpit with ample seating and storage, making it suitable for both fishing and cruising.

Powerful Performance: Equipped with twin outboard engines that deliver strong acceleration and efficient cruising speeds.

Fishing Amenities: Includes rod holders, live wells, and a large fish box, catering to serious anglers.

Comfort Features: Equipped with a comfortable helm area, optional hardtop with electronics mounting, and a cabin with a berth and marine head for overnight stays.

Quality Construction: Known for durable materials and excellent build quality, ensuring longevity and resale value.

Cons

Price Point: Positioned at a premium price compared to some competitors, reflecting its quality but potentially limiting budget-conscious buyers.

Fuel Consumption: Twin engines offer performance but can lead to higher fuel costs, especially at top speeds.

Limited Cabin Space: While the cabin offers a berth and head, it is relatively compact, limiting extended liveaboard comfort.

Weight: The solid construction contributes to a heavier boat, which may affect trailering and fuel efficiency when compared to lighter models.
